What Are Trade-In Limits?

Trade-in limits refer to the maximum value or number of items that can be exchanged within a specific period or under certain promotional offers. These limits are often set by manufacturers, retailers, or service providers to manage inventory and promotional costs.

Factors Affecting Trade-In Limits in 2026

  • Promotional Campaigns: Special offers may have increased or decreased limits.
  • Device or Item Type: Different categories may have varying limits.
  • Customer Loyalty: Repeat customers might enjoy higher trade-in caps.
  • Regulatory Changes: New laws could influence trade-in policies.

Strategies to Maximize Your Trade-In Benefits

To get the most out of your trade-in in 2026, consider the following strategies:

  • Stay Informed: Keep up with the latest trade-in offers and limits from your preferred brands.
  • Upgrade Timing: Plan your upgrades around promotional periods with higher limits.
  • Prepare Your Items: Ensure your devices or items are in excellent condition to maximize value.
  • Combine Offers: Look for opportunities to combine trade-in deals with other discounts.

Common Trade-In Items and Their Limits in 2026

Different items have different trade-in limits. Here are some common categories:

  • Smartphones: Often capped at a certain dollar amount, depending on model and condition.
  • Laptops and Tablets: Limits vary based on age, condition, and brand.
  • Vehicles: Trade-in value depends on make, model, mileage, and condition.
  • Gaming Consoles: Usually have set maximum trade-in values during promotional periods.
